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Lowestoft to Chorleywood start from as little as £21.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Lowestoft to Chorleywood start from £78.00 one way, or £79.00 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Lowestoft to Chorleywood are available for £102.30 one way, or £162.70 return

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Station Amenities and Services

Lowestoft Station is equipped with facilities designed to cater to travelers’ needs. For those buying tickets, the station offers both a staffed ticket office with accessible opening hours during the week (Monday to Friday, 06:40 to 17:05, and on Sundays from 08:00 to 16:15) and modern ticket machines that accommodate online tickets. To address inclusivity, the ticket machines provide accessible service to all passengers.

The station prioritizes passenger comfort, providing a seating area and a waiting room open during the same hours. Although the station lacks a first-class lounge, it ensures a comfortable environment for all passengers. You'll find toilets in the station building, with no requirement for a radar key, catering to everyone's comfort. Additionally, the station features a free water refill point and a shop operated by the Lowestoft Central Project for refreshments and tourist information.

Noteworthy is the station's commitment to accessibility. Step-free access is available throughout, aligning with the ORR station classification system. Beyond this, the station staff are on hand from morning till early evening throughout the week to provide travel assistance, reinforce information, and offer support for any passenger requiring extra help during their journey. There’s also a dedicated customer services helpline available, ensuring that help is never far if needed.

Onward Travel Options from Lowestoft Station

Convenience extends beyond the station thanks to comprehensive onward travel options. Rail replacement services are comfortably accessible directly outside the station by Platform 2. For those looking to utilize local bus services, Lowestoft is a designated PlusBus location, offering travelers integrated access to bus services that can augment their travel plans efficiently. PlusBus offers economical tickets that combine rail and unlimited bus travel within specified areas, ensuring seamless connectivity for your onward adventures.

Facilities and Amenities at Chorleywood

Chorleywood station, though it lacks a traditional ticket office, ensures seamless travel preparations with available ticket machines. However, please note that tickets purchased online cannot be collected at these machines, and there's no provision for issuing or validating Smartcards. While there’s an induction loop to support the hearing impaired, the station does not have accessible ticket machines, which may require additional planning for some travelers.

In terms of accessibility, Chorleywood prides itself on inclusive travel solutions. With step-free access throughout, reaching the platforms is a breeze, thanks to level pathways and a ramped subway. Although there's no dedicated staff help available, assistance via the Passenger Assist service can be requested, ensuring travel confidence at any time of the day. For further travel assistance, a help point is also present on site.

Onward Travel Choices

For those connecting their journeys beyond the rails, Chorleywood station facilitates a variety of transport links. You’ll find the Metropolitan Line directly from the station, giving you easy access to London’s vast underground network. If buses are more your speed, a rail replacement service is conveniently located just outside the station’s main entrance, adjacent to the southbound platform.

A mini cab office is also stationed nearby for those unpredictable journeys where time is of the essence or when you prefer a more personalized travel experience. While the station doesn't directly link to airports, a quick interchange in Central London opens doors to Gatwick, Heathrow, Stansted, and London City.
